The core difference

A buffet gives guests choice and flexible portions. A plated dinner creates a more formal pace and consistent presentation. Neither is automatically better; the right choice depends on the venue, group size, budget, schedule and atmosphere.

Buffet considerations

Buffets can work beautifully for corporate events, community gatherings and weddings with varied preferences. They need smart room flow, adequate serving space and a plan for guests with mobility needs. In tight downtown rooms, buffet lines can interrupt speeches or networking if the layout is not planned.

Plated considerations

Plated meals suit formal dinners and venues with strong back-of-house support. They require accurate counts, menu choices, place cards or service notes, and enough staff to serve hot food promptly. They can be less forgiving if guests change seats or meal selections are incomplete.

Decision guide

Choose buffet when variety, relaxed timing and mixed preferences matter. Choose plated when formality, pacing and presentation matter. Ask your caterer what has worked well in your venue type, especially if there are elevators, long corridors or limited staging space.
